Yesterday, I mentioned a great resource called WISCAT for searching the holdings of Wisconsin’s libraries. But you can also use Google and Yahoo to find out if a library in your area has a particular item.
In cooperation with WorldCat, a catalog of libraries worldwide, both Google and Yahoo have added the “find in a library” search syntax. Say, for example, that you would like to check out the book, The Da Vinci Code, from a local library. Simply go to either Google or Yahoo and enter the search find in a library: Da Vinci Code
The first item in your search results should be “Find in a Library: The Da Vinci code” Click on it to open the WorldCat record, then enter in your zip code. You should receive a list of libraries in your area that have the item. If the name of the library appears as a link, click on it to get the call number.
